About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i

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i is a 62-apartment assisted living community at 564 W. Main Street in Lehi, Utah. The doors opened in June 2023, which makes it one of the newest senior buildings in Utah Valley. The property is owned and operated by Larry H. Miller Senior Health, the same family business behind the broader Larry H. Miller automotive and sports holdings, and the building shows that scale of investment in finishes, amenities, and clinical infrastructure.

The care model covers full assistance with bathing, dressing, eating, and toileting, with the staff also working with residents who have moderate dementia. Clinical depth is one of the property's stronger features, a registered nurse stays on call 24 hours, both awake and asleep night-shift staff cover the overnight, and the pull-cord system in every room is configured to alert staff or contact 911 directly in a true emergency.

The community is pet-friendly and runs as private-pay. Day-to-day life moves through resort-style common spaces, including a welcome lobby anchored by a 25-foot stone fireplace, a full-service beauty salon, and a restaurant-style dining room serving freshly prepared meals at set times. The on-site Physical Therapy Gym is uncommon at the assisted-living level and gives residents access to strength and mobility work without an outside appointment.

The open central courtyard adds a usable outdoor space across most of the year. Staff kindness through difficult move-in transitions, recognition of residents by name, and the energy around resident parties and celebrations are the defining features of day-to-day life here. There is no dedicated memory-care wing, the assisted-living side accommodates moderate dementia rather than late-stage care. The property sits on Main Street in central Lehi, a few minutes from the I-15 Lehi exit.

Mountain Point Medical Center is roughly 5 minutes away for medical care or emergencies, and American Fork is about 5 minutes south for shopping and casual dining. The Outlets at Traverse Mountain are 10 minutes north, and families driving up from Salt Lake County reach the property in 25 to 30 minutes via I-15. Aspen Ridge sits in the Larry H. Miller Senior Health portfolio, which is the senior-living arm of the broader Larry H.

Miller Group, a name many Utah families already recognize from automotive, real estate, and sports ventures. The 2023 build year, the on-site PT gym, and the round-the-clock clinical coverage are the property's defining features in the Utah Valley assisted-living set.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of care does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i offer?

Assisted living with full support for daily activities, plus accommodation for residents managing moderate dementia. The license does not include a dedicated memory-care wing.

How much does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i cost?

Pricing begins around $3,800 per month, with the actual figure tied to room type and care intensity. A current rate sheet comes through your senior advisor before the tour.

Does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i accept Medicaid?

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i operates as a private-pay community. Families needing a Medicaid placement can ask an advisor to identify alternatives across Utah Valley.

Where is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i located?

564 W. Main Street in Lehi, Utah, 84043, in central Utah Valley. Mountain Point Medical Center is about 5 minutes away, and the I-15 Lehi exit is a few minutes east.

How many apartments does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i have?

62 apartments across the building, in studio and one-bedroom layouts. The 2023 build year shows in the modern finishes and the layout choices.

What dining is available?

Three meals a day come out of the in-house kitchen and are served restaurant-style in the main dining room. Holiday and family meals are arranged on request.

What activities and amenities are offered?

An on-site Physical Therapy Gym, a full-service beauty salon, music programs, religious services brought on-site, group games and crafts, and a resident-event calendar with parties and celebrations that anchor the social rhythm.

Does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i allow pets?

Yes, pets are accommodated at the community. Specific size, breed, and any pet-fee considerations are best confirmed with the community on tour.

Who operates Aspen Ridge Residences of Lehi?

Larry H. Miller Senior Health, the senior-living arm of the broader Larry H. Miller Group of Utah businesses. Aspen Ridge is one of Aspen Ridge's newer Utah Valley properties.
